Skip to main content

Migration Prep Tool

The Migration Prep Tool for Server is a utility that allows for a pre-migration of a database of workflows and apps to be more quickly migrated to the new AES256 standard.

This Migration Prep Tool is optional and a separate command line utility. You only need to run it once before you upgrade from Server 2022.1 (or earlier versions) to 2022.3.x or newer.

Note

Why Did We Create This Tool?

Server is updating its cryptography to use AES256 for data at rest. All existing cryptographically stored data needs to migrate from its current encryption method to the new one. Some of this data can be migrated in advance of the upgrade to 2022.3 while your Server is in production.

The most time-consuming data that needs to migrate are the apps and workflows stored in Server. This data can be migrated in advance to save time when performing the upgrade to Server 2022.3.

Alteryx created the Migration Prep Tool to assist you in migrating this data before the upgrade.

When to Use the Migration Prep Tool

We recommend you run the Migration Prep Tool in these cases:

  • If the Server installation you are upgrading is a production system or a development system that can't be down for more than a few hours, and

  • You have more than a few hundred workflows, and

  • You are running on MongoDB Atlas or user-managed MongoDB.

Even if these cases do not apply to you, it is best practice to run the Migration Prep Tool before attempting an upgrade to ensure success.

Further, you might also consider the size of db.AS_App_Chunks.dataSize() and AS_PackageDefinitions. We don’t have recommendations related to the database size for when you should run the Migration Prep Tool in prep mode.

If you only have a few workflows or you don’t mind if Server takes several hours to days to upgrade, you can skip using the Migration Prep Tool and run the standard Server installer to upgrade to 2022.3. The downtime will be longer than usual since the crypto migration will be part of the upgrade.

Note

If you choose to not run the Migration Prep Tool before the upgrade, the tool will be installed and run as part of the 2022.3 upgrade installation.

What's Next?

Prepare for Migration

Run the Migration Prep Tool

Migration Prep Tool FAQs